The seat of Melbourne Ports will be the next inner city seat to falter.

It is not that Danby is a poor representative, he is not. (nor is Kennelly or Gillard). He is just let down by ineffective and unprofessional support staff. His office demonstrates the problems that the can occur if your administrative support is not up to scratch and not engagged in the local community.

Michael Danby’s office has been in disarray ever since Tonya Stephens and Tony Williams resigned.

During the last Federal election Danby’s office was unable to properly staff polling booths. (Something that Keneally also faced in NSW). The St Kilda booth, one of the biggest in Melbourne Ports, went unmanned. In the past St Kilda would have been the most supported booth. Volunteers were not organised or not forthcoming. If it was not for myself and Tony Lupton the ALP would have had no one handing out during the lunch time rush.

Danby’s Office has also come under criticism within the party for failing to provide local support to the State campaign. With the exception of Jane Sheldon Danby’s office was noted for their disengagment with the campaign.
